Location: Leeds, West Yorkshire

Salary: From 38,000 per annum + overtime (potential earnings up to 60,000)

Bonus: 10% sign-on bonus + company-wide bonus scheme

Shifts: Day and night shifts available with shift premiums

Sector: Precision Engineering / Aerospace / Medical / Advanced Manufacturing

The Opportunity

We are recruiting experienced CNC Millers to join a modern precision engineering facility manufacturing complex, high-specification components used across advanced engineering sectors. You will be working with multi-axis CNC machines in a quality-driven environment offering excellent earning potential, modern equipment and long-term career opportunities.

Key Responsibilities

  • Set and operate CNC milling machines (3 axis and/or 5 axis)
  • Prepare machines including tooling, fixtures, offsets and probes
  • Load and edit CNC programs using CAM software or G-code
  • Perform first-off inspection and in-process checks
  • Machine precision components to tight tolerances

How to prepare for a job interview at Elevation People Solutions

✨Know Your CNC Stuff

Make sure you brush up on your knowledge of CNC milling machines, especially 3-axis and 5-axis operations. Be ready to discuss your experience with tooling, fixtures, and offsets, as well as any CAM software or G-code you've used.

✨Show Off Your Precision Skills

Prepare to talk about how you've achieved tight tolerances in your previous roles. Bring examples of projects where you performed first-off inspections and in-process checks, as this will demonstrate your attention to detail and commitment to quality.

✨Understand the Industry

Familiarise yourself with the sectors you'll be working in, like aerospace and medical. Knowing the specific challenges and standards in these industries can give you an edge and show that you're genuinely interested in the role.
